Output ec88329f533e6d5ac60f28f0a829657c120dc4755d1ff5e77ac82ebc06d763ad:0

value
268272
script pubkey
OP_0 OP_PUSHBYTES_20 b80a747c203c3083f2542fb7ef04dd29c62a6a12
address
bc1qhq98glpq8scg8uj597m77pxa98rz56sjnmmuge
transaction
ec88329f533e6d5ac60f28f0a829657c120dc4755d1ff5e77ac82ebc06d763ad
spent
true